Chersotis fimbriola

(Chersotis fimbriola)

Description

Chersotis fimbriola is a moth of the Noctuidae family. It is found in number of isolated populations from Austria to Spain, Morocco, Turkey, Iraq, Iran and Turkmenistan. Adults are on wing from June to August. There is one generation per year. The larvae feed on various herbaceous plants.
